Hello guys. I'm in need of your knowledge. A guy posted an online ad for a Strat, and I want to know if it's the real deal. He did a lot of crazy mods on it, but I'm only interested for the body and neck anyway. There are some things that popped in my eye:
- the serial number in starting with N, which makes it a 1998-1999 guitar ( or maybe an early '90s ... the whole serial number mix)
- I dd some research but that spaghetti logo doesn't appear anywhere on those years
- the tuners look like 1998-1999, the saddles also, but the bridge has 6 screw holes
- it has no trussrod cover, which should indicate a '60s reissue, but again with that logo and serial placement...
- the tuner bushings seem wrong
Can you tell me more about this guitar? I know it's hard to tell with all that mumbo jumbo on it...
